Recalling the Past From the Present
Sometimes when we recall memory, we have autobiographical memory. You're reacting as if it's right now, but really the memory was in the past. And this is why recognizing and differentiating the past from the present is helpful. It isn't helpful to use denial as a coping strategy. The primary part of the brain that's responsible for memory is what we call the hippocampus.
